Quanta Sets Up Product Design Center to Cut Procurement Cost
|
|
|
|
| 24 February 2009 |
|
|
|
|
Quanta Computer Inc, the world`s largest contract manufacturer of notebook computers, recently established the PDC (product design center) masterminded by vice chairman CC Leung with the assistance of CF Cheng and CH Chang, both of whom were in charge of the supply chain for Dell Computer products.
Leung noted the PDC is created to integrate components procurements and uniform product specifications. Quanta estimated its can slash $30 million in procurement of mechanical parts based on shipping 30 million notebook computers each year.
Quanta Chairman Barry Lam said his company would launch some innovative products and take aggressive actions to cut production costs, which will be carried out by Leung.
Quanta shipped 10.1 million NBs in the fourth quarter of last year, predicting it would ship seven million NBs in the first quarter of this year, down 30 percent from the preceding quarter.
But Quanta believes it would see growth in shipments of NBs after the second quarter of this year because of the anticipated launch of innovative NB models. While boosting sales volume, the company will strive to maintain consolidated operating profit margin at 5 percent by controlling production costs this year. To meet that goal, the company will control expenditure ratio to between 2.5 and 3 percent of total production value this year.
